Ssh
通過 SSH 遠端打開 GNOME 會話
我有一台筆記型電腦以無線方式連接到我的家庭網路。我計劃在我的網路上安裝一個 CentOS 伺服器,用於 Web 伺服器、文件伺服器和實驗。我想以雙啟動的形式從我的筆記型電腦上訪問它——一個是主作業系統,另一個是一個非常簡單的系統,它會自動啟動到伺服器的遠端連接並在伺服器上打開一個 GNOME 會話然後顯示在我的電腦上。我正在考慮使用 Arch Linux 作為將連接到伺服器的作業系統,因為我一直想嘗試一段時間,而且它似乎相當可配置。
我的問題如下:
- 如何在我的筆記型電腦上啟動控制另一台電腦的 GNOME 會話(沒有 ssh -X 隧道或 VNC 遠端控制;我希望我的電腦成為伺服器的“啞終端”)?
- 速度會成為無線的問題嗎?SSH 壓縮會有幫助嗎?
- Arch Linux 確實是終端作業系統的最佳選擇嗎?
正如 sarnold 所說,XDMCP 應該是您正在尋找的東西。但是,如果“我希望我的電腦成為一個‘啞終端’”不是硬性要求,我會鼓勵您改用 NX(例如由FreeNX實現)。它是通過 SSH 進行 X 轉發的改進版本,但它需要您的筆記型電腦上的桌面環境來執行它的 GUI。但是,它有幾個優點,主要是頻寬使用。
這將我們帶到您的第二個問題:X 轉發應該在 100 MBit 網路上正常工作。壓縮很可能是不必要的。但是,X 確實需要一些頻寬,尤其是當您的螢幕上有動畫內容時。因此,為了騰出您的網路進行其他傳輸,NX 所需的低頻寬會有所幫助。
關於你的第三個問題:嗯,Arch 有一個滾動發布原則,這意味著有一個連續的更新流。這對舊機器很好,因為它可以定制,因此它可以完美地與您的機器配合使用,並且有很好的文件。你絕對可以讓它變得非常苗條和高效,這比“修剪” SuSE / Fedora / CentOS/… 安裝更容易。然而,如果你真的只需要一個啞終端,滾動發布系統可能不如使用簡單的 Debian 安裝或類似的東西實用,你可以通過最少的更新長時間保持“穩定”。